The Residence Inn Miami Airport has two restaurants and used to provide a shuttle service to the port but this service is not longer offered. You can always check at the front desk for latest shuttle information. If you prefer to take a taxi or Uber the cost is about $15 to $36 one way, depending on time of day and traffic.

Another option to consider is the MIA Metromover, a complimentary shuttle train operational 24/7. This service can transport you throughout Downtown Miami in just 30 minutes from Miami International Airport. Although it doesn’t go directly to the cruise port, it provides a budget-friendly alternative for part of the journey.

The InterContinental At Doral Miami is a great choice for your cruising needs. Their cruise package provides guests with free parking for up to 14 days, complimentary airport and hotel transportation, as well as a $30 Uber gift card to cover transportation to the cruise port. Additionally, guests will be upgraded to the club floor with a full breakfast buffet for two. With neighborhoods spread across an area of about 55 square miles, you can cover more ground when not exploring by foot. Lincoln Road is lined with lively bars and is a popular spot to enjoy a walk, and the Bass Museum of Art is also in the area. To the north is Midtown and the hip Design District, while Cuban culture flourishes with authentic Latin restaurants and shops in Little Havana to the west. Coconut Grove is a lush part of the city with historic sites, fine dining and luxury hotels.
